Starting With Stocks: How Beginners Can Learn With Confidence

The majority of Australians still use stock trading as an avenue to learn about the market. If you are a beginner, the very first thing you should do is to familiarize yourself with how the Australian Securities Exchange (ASX) operates. It is the place where you become a part-owner of a company through purchasing shares, and your objective is to make money through either an increase in the stock price or dividends.

The Path to Starting

1. Stock Market Basics – Get to know the terms like shares, market indices and dividends.

2. A trading account – Open one that has a friendly interface for beginners and minimal charges.

3. Market analysis – Learn about the past and present of the major sectors like mining, banking, tech and healthcare.

4. Mastering risk management – Set a stop-loss or devise a strategy before making any trades.

Forex Trading: A Global Currency Market with Opportunities Forex (foreign exchange) is the largest and most liquid market in the world. Forex doesn't close, unlike stocks, and trades for 24 hours during the business week, which gives traders flexibility and global exposure.



Reasons Why Australians Forex
  • Very Low investment
  • Trading opportunities in many currencies
  • High liquidity leading to fast execution of orders
  • User-friendly platforms with advanced charting and analytics tools Main Concepts to Learn
  • Currency pairs (AUD/USD, EUR/USD, GBP/JPY, etc.)
  • Leverage – A very powerful tool that calls for proper management
  • Technical analysis – Indicators, candlesticks, and chart patterns
  • Economic news – Interest rates, GDP, inflation, and employment figures

If you are a forex novice, it is strongly suggested that you learn in a structured manner. Start with demo accounts, familiarize yourself with the economic calendars, and become a pro in one strategy before moving to the next. Commodities Trading: Gold, Oil, and More Australia, being a country rich in resources, has many local traders for commodities trading. Energy (oil, gas), metals (gold, silver) and agricultural products are included in the commodity market.

The Factors Making Commodities Interesting
  • Global supply and demand influencing the price with strong trends
  • A good opportunity to not only invest in stocks and currencies but also gain exposure to commodities
  • A chance to make profits in both bull and bear markets
How to Approach Commodity Trading
  • Start with one or two instruments (e.g. gold or crude oil)
  • Analyze macroeconomic and geopolitics factors
  • Consider trend-following or breakout strategies
  • Use strict risk controls to manage volatility

Commodities can be a source of great profit but a determined approach will be needed because of the drastic movements in prices.

The Need of a Well-Planned Learning Path 

Although one can learn by oneself, the winning traders would often be following a planned path that consists of:

1. Education Building a firm foundation through reading, participating in stock trading classes, and completing courses in stock market trading.

2. Practice Test your strategies using demo accounts without the risk of losing real money.

3. Strategy Development Select your trading style—day trading, swing trading, or long-term investing—and stick to it.

4. Risk Management Determine the percentage of your capital you are ready to lose in a single trade. Professionals usually take 1–2% risk.

5. Psychology Even great strategies can be destroyed by emotions. Patience, discipline, and consistency are more important than quick wins.
